Canada's economy better than expected in last quarter of 2024, new numbers show
The Canadian economy outpaced expectations in the final quarter of the year, Statistics Canada said Friday, thanks largely to a surge in household spending. Real gross domestic product rose 2.6 per cent on an annualized basis in the fourth quarter,
